Can You Cook With Cast Iron On Ceramic Stove. The short answer is yes. Your ceramic cooktop can handle the use of very heavy cookware like cast iron pans, both enameled and regular. However, you need to be extra careful when doing so. Plopping a cast iron skillet down too aggressively can cause a crack in your stovetop, or worse.
